RED NOSES is one of the largest and leading healthcare clown organisations in the world on a mission to share the healing power of laughter through the art of clowning. Today, RED NOSES partner offices operate in Austria, Croatia, Czech Republic, Germany, Hungary, Jordan, Lithuania, Palestine, Poland, Slovakia, and Slovenia. Across these numerous locations, RED NOSES work together with vulnerable audiences such as children in hospitals, older citizens in geriatric facilities, children with disabilities and people affected by crisis. RED NOSES International, based in Vienna, acts as the headquarter and supports the activities of the locally led organisations by monitoring and ensuring the implementation of the organisation’s strategic goals.
